Providence, RI (August 9, 2025) – Emergency crews responded to a three-vehicle collision Friday evening at 390 Hope Street in Providence. The crash occurred around 7:14 p.m. on August 8 and resulted in at least one person being hurt. Paramedics treated the injured at the scene before transporting them to a local hospital for further evaluation.

 

Police temporarily restricted traffic in the area to allow first responders to assist those involved and to clear damaged vehicles from the roadway. The circumstances leading to the crash have not yet been released, and the incident is under active investigation. Drivers in the area experienced brief delays while tow trucks and cleanup crews worked to restore the road to normal conditions. Officials have not confirmed whether additional injuries occurred.

Car Accidents in Rhode Island

 

In Rhode Island, multi-vehicle crashes often occur in areas with higher traffic volume, particularly during evening hours. These types of collisions can result from distracted driving, tailgating, or sudden stops, and they frequently lead to multiple injuries. Even low-speed impacts can cause significant damage and require medical attention for those involved. Some factors that often play a role in multi-vehicle accidents include:

 

  • Chain-Reaction Collisions: When one vehicle strikes another, the force can push it into a third, causing multiple impacts and injuries.

  • Reduced Reaction Time: Heavy traffic can limit space for braking or maneuvering to avoid a crash.

  • Driver Distraction: Taking eyes off the road for even a few seconds can result in failing to notice slowing or stopped traffic ahead.

  • Weather and Lighting Conditions: Low light in the evening or rain-slicked roads can make it harder to stop in time, increasing the risk of a pileup.
